#980bc7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#980bc7 is composed of 59.6% red, 4.3% green and 78%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.6% cyan, 94.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 285 degrees, a saturation of 89.5% and a lightness of 41.2%. #980bc7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ff16ff with #31008f. Closest websafe color is: #9900cc.

Shades and Tints of #980bc7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a010d is the darkest color, while #fdfaff is the lightest one.

Tones of #980bc7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c646e is the less saturated color, while #9c03cf is the most saturated one.
